Exploring the Efficacy of Semaglutide in Research
The pharmaceutical landscape is constantly evolving, with researchers continually seeking innovative solutions for obesity and related health synthink research chemicals reviews conditions. This GLP-1 receptor agonist has emerged as a potent player in this field, generating considerable interest due to its impressive weight loss potential.
- Scientific studies have demonstrated that Semaglutide can effectively minimize body weight and improve metabolic parameters in individuals with obesity.
- , Additionally, research suggests that Semaglutide may offer additional benefits beyond weight loss, such as improved blood sugar control and reduced cardiovascular risk factors.
